What was the most interesting question?

"No one question in particular. I thought the whole interview was a pretty good conversation from start to finish" Report Response | I was asked this question too

What was the most difficult question?

"How would I feel about learning medicine in an urban medical envirnoment where the patient population was largely minorities that didnt take good care of themselves. Would I go into medicine if the system became socialized Explain my poor grades in my junior and senior years. " Report Response | I was asked this question too

How did you prepare for the interview?

"Had talking points for the majors (why medicine, why NJMS) and looked over the interview feedback for questions in the past. I got the impression they dont change their questions much and they didnt. " Report Response

What impressed you positively?

"How much the students liked the school. How well people matched into competitive residencies for a state school. Learned that out of state people get in state tuition! " Report Response

What did you wish you had known ahead of time?

"Parking is a major headache so prepare to park illegally if you dont get there super early." Report Response

What are your general comments?

"I arrived an hour earlier than scheduled so the admssions people were kind enough to give me a lunch ticket to grab some chow before the tour. The waiting room in the admissions office is pretty chilly and the other person I was interviewing with kept to herself so the waiting was pretty boring. As for the interview, I dont know if they make an effort to match people according to their applications but I had a scary amount of rapport and common interests with the person I interviewed with. The admissions people at NJMS did a fabulous job or I just lucked out completely. " Report Response
